Choose Your Development Approach
There are multiple ways to build an app in 2025:
- No-Code/Low-Code Platforms: Ideal for beginners. Platforms like Bubble, Adalo, and OutSystems allow you to create an app with minimal coding.
- Native Development: Using Swift for iOS and Kotlin for Android ensures high performance and flexibility.
- Cross-Platform Development: Frameworks like Flutter and React Native allow you to build apps for both iOS and Android simultaneously.
- AI-Assisted Development: AI-powered tools like GitHub Copilot can help generate code and automate development tasks.

Develop Your App
Once the planning phase is complete, start building your app:
- Backend Development: Use cloud services like Firebase or AWS Amplify for database and authentication.
- Frontend Development: Develop the user interface using your chosen framework.
- API Integration: Connect third-party services like payment gateways (Stripe, PayPal) or AI tools (ChatGPT API) to enhance functionality.
Test Your App Thoroughly
Testing ensures your app is free from bugs and delivers a smooth experience. Key testing methods include:
- Manual Testing: Check for UI/UX consistency and navigation issues.
- Automated Testing: Use tools like Selenium and Appium for efficient bug detection.
- Beta Testing: Release a test version to a small group via TestFlight (iOS) or Google Play Console (Android).
